Both of your bikes will be similar as how to check things.
Service manual is a good investment.
YouTube has videos that may help you

You can start by getting the bike off the ground. Level the frame, get a magnetic level on the front and rear rotors and check to see if everything is level and plumb. A good place to start and easy to do.
The engine (and the rear swing arm) may be leaning to one side. This will tell you if you need new motor mounts .
There are front engine stabilizers available that are adjustable to level the engine (swing arm).
